什么叫子网站10大免费软件下载
web/
2025/9/29 13:53:57/
文章来源:
什么叫子网站,10大免费软件下载,湛江人才网,红杏直播1.数据库的相关介绍
关系型数据库管理系统#xff1a;#xff08;英文简称#xff1a;RDBMS#xff09;
为我们提供了一种存储数据的特定格式#xff0c;所谓的数据格式就是表#xff0c;
在数据库中一张表就称为是一种关系.
在关系型数据库中表由两部分组成#xf…1.数据库的相关介绍
关系型数据库管理系统英文简称RDBMS
为我们提供了一种存储数据的特定格式所谓的数据格式就是表
在数据库中一张表就称为是一种关系.
在关系型数据库中表由两部分组成第一部分是字段column第二部分叫做记录record 在表中的每一类数据就是一种字段在表中每一个数据录入就是一条记录。
在关系型数据库中表是不能单独存在的想创建表就要先有数据库的存在
在RDBMS中存储数据的结构是在数据库中去创建表在表中有字段column和记录record组成。
在RDBMS中的数据库的表中可以设置一些限制条件这些限制条件的加入使得用户录入数据的统一规范。 2.对RDBMS中数据库中表的限制条件的介绍:
约束 constraint
1.域约束在字段上进行数据类型的限制。为了确保在表中每一列的数据格式的统一。
2.检查性约束在字段上进行一个数据的判断满足条件则录入数据形成一条记录如果不满足条件则返回错误。确保数据的合理性。
3.主键约束primary key数据第一不能重复第二填入数据的时候这一列不能为空通常为编号的字段设置主键约束。
注意一张表只能有一个主键约束。通常为编号的字段设置主键约束。
4.惟一键约束unique key数据不能重复但是数据可以为空。
一张表中可以存在多个惟一键。
典型的IP地址不可能出现重复
5.外键约束Foreign key:也就是说外键约束是多张表之间的一种联系如果录入数据的编号在对应的表中找不到对应的编号则整行信息作废不能录入表中。确保数据的完整性准确性但是录入数据的速度会降低。
子表与母表应该通过唯一性数据进行联系必须保证联系子表与母表之间的数据编号是不重复的。 维护数据完整性外键约束确保了引用完整性Referential Integrity即两个相关联的表之间的数据一致性。当在一个表从表或子表中插入或更新记录时外键约束会检查这些操作是否与另一个表主表或父表中的相关记录相匹配。例如如果子表中的外键列必须引用主表中已存在的主键值那么外键约束会阻止插入或更新一个不存在于主表中的外键值从而避免了孤立数据和无效引用。
在RDBMS中如何避免数据的冗余
在RDBMS中为了避免重复的重要手段之一就是把表拆掉将一张表拆成两张表。
在数据库中最重要的就是对字段的设计而每一张表都需要进行域约束
在数据库中最难的主要就是字段的设计。在数据库中每一张表都要去设置域约束。
数据的冗余
数据冗余Data Redundancy是指在数据库或数据存储系统中存储了超过一次的相同数据或可以由其他数据推导出来的数据。
3.事务
事务Transaction
启动事务准备做一项工作
回滚事务如果经过检查发现操作错误。则回滚事务重新操作。
当启动事务后经过检查之后发现操作无误则提交事务操作生效。 作用确保多个操作要么全成功要么全失败。
4.关系型数据库管理系统的软件
Oracle 商业软件
MySQL 早期是开源软件
mariadb-server 开源软件除了名字跟MySQL不一样其他都差不多。
SQL Server 微软的收费软件互联网人不用。
postgresql
华为 GaussDB
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/83927.shtml
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!